Data shared with Subcontractors. <br />a. If the Subcontractor cannot protect the Data described in this Contract, then the contract with the <br />subcontractor must be submitted to the DCYF Contact specified for this contract for reviewand <br />approval. <br />b. The Contractor shall not share any Data with the Subcontractor until the Contractor receives such <br />approval. <br />15. Notification of Compromise or Potential Compromise <br />a. The Contractor shall notify DCYF by way of the Contracts and Procurement Office email at <br />dcyf.contractdatabreach@dcyf.wa.gov within one (1) business day, after becoming aware of any <br />potential, suspected, attempted or actual breach that has compromised or the potential to <br />compromise DCYF shared Data. <br />b. The Contractor shall take all necessary steps to mitigate the harmful effects of such breach of <br />security. <br />c. The Contractor agrees to defend, protect and hold harmless DCYF for any damages related to a <br />breach of security by their staff. <br />16. Breach of Data <br />a. In the event of a breach by the Contractor of this Exhibit and in addition to all other rights and <br />remedies available to DCYF, DCYF may elect to do any of the following: <br />(1) Require that the Contractor return all Data to DCYF that was previously provided to the <br />Contractor by DCYF; and/or <br />(2) Suspend the Contractor's access to accounts and other information; and/or <br />(3) Terminate the Contract. <br />Department of Children, Youth & Families <br />2017CF County Program Agreement 6-24-20 Page26 <br />
